XRT began a target of opportunity observation of GRB140901B, detected  
by Swift-BAT (Cummings, GCN Circ. 16773) and Fermi-GBM (Zhang, Circ.  
16775). Swift slewed to the burst on 2014-09-05.

Observations with the XRT began at 01:23:58 UT, i.e., 330 ks after the  
trigger, and comprised a total of 2.97 ks in photon counting mode.

We do not detect any X-ray sources, within the BAT error circle  
(Cummings, GCN Circ. 16773), with S/N>2. We place a 3-sigma upper  
limit on the count rate at the BAT position of 3.85E-03 cts/s.
